Transaction 143e2408cf84103ec32ec9275c103d8a3cd670fff79eb6d957e1404db6a69a84
1 Input
3 Outputs
- 143e2408cf84103ec32ec9275c103d8a3cd670fff79eb6d957e1404db6a69a84:0
- 143e2408cf84103ec32ec9275c103d8a3cd670fff79eb6d957e1404db6a69a84:1
- 143e2408cf84103ec32ec9275c103d8a3cd670fff79eb6d957e1404db6a69a84:2
value 60000000
address 37LmXD7YpuUauyfuvwiMAbVaaRtCrEcy2i
value 292887
address 3Hv3JTY2zDuAHM2nSJa4PW9s9KuqSeRKmA
value 5847787820
address 1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C